All thirty Sri Lankans measured for August 2026 are living, so the Alive reading is the same order, read as a story of eras.
Sri Lanka's living reading matches the standard one name for name, since nobody measured has died. For August 2026 the interest lies in how the cricketers below the two presidents sort into generations. Anura Kumara Dissanayake, in office since September 2024, leads at 9.2, and Chandrika Kumaratunga, president from 1994 to 2005, is second at 5.2.
The 1990s and 2000s are represented by Chaminda Vaas, seventh, and Arjuna Ranatunga, eleventh, whose 1996 World Cup captaincy is still the country's best-known cricketing moment. Nuwan Kulasekara, Rangana Herath, Ajantha Mendis and Thisara Perera, all retired, cover the 2000s and 2010s. Angelo Mathews, who captained across all formats, sits between the eras at tenth.
The current side holds the top cricket places. Dhananjaya de Silva, the Test captain, and Asitha Fernando are level at 3.9 in third and fourth. Dinesh Chandimal is fifth, Kusal Mendis sixth, Dasun Shanaka eighth, and Charith Asalanka, the ODI captain, fifteenth at 1.5. Three captains from three formats sit on one list, none of them scoring above four.
That is the notable feature of the living reading: after the two politicians, no Sri Lankan holds a fame score above 3.9. The world's attention on the country is real but shallow, spread across a squad rather than concentrated in a single star, and every person carrying it is still alive to add to it.

What famous means here
Fame, in iFAMOUS, is how widely the world knows a name: how recognisable a person's name, face or work is, and how well people know who they are. It is assessed from extensive historical and current public data, some of it reaching back more than twenty years, and it is not merit, talent, importance or popularity on iFANN. The rankings model real-world global fame, not internet fame; the data is the instrument, not the subject. Activity on iFANN itself is excluded.
The month in the title is the date of this edition, not the period measured. The list is a snapshot of overall fame as it stood when the issue was frozen: a name does not lose its place because one month was quiet, and a trending moment alone does not put a name here. How the list was ranked
The iFANN Global Fame Rankings combine worldwide Wikipedia readership across languages, worldwide news coverage and search interest anchored against stable reference names, with search history reaching back to 2004. A twelve-month baseline sits behind the current reading and short-lived surges are capped, so the list reflects durable recognition rather than one week of headlines. Rankings are computed daily on ifann.net and frozen on the second day of the following month as that month's issue; a published issue never changes.
